WebJun 22, 2024 · 1. Abrasion: A cut or scrape that typically isn’t serious. 2. Abscess: A tender, fluid-filled pocket that forms in tissue, usually due to infection. 3. Acute: Signifies a condition that begins abruptly and is sometimes severe, but the duration is short. 4. Benign: Not cancerous. 5. Biopsy: A small sample of tissue that’s taken for testing. 6. Here are some common general medical terms: Abrasion: A scrape or cut that is generally not serious. Abscess: A fluid-filled pocket that's tender and often forms in tissue as a result of an infection. Root: The root gives a term its essential meaning.
